Midlothian, nestled in the southwest part of Richmond, VA, offers a charming blend of suburban comfort and vibrant community spirit, making it an ideal spot for those relocating to the area. This neighborhood is especially appealing for families and professionals who appreciate a peaceful environment with plenty of amenities nearby. Residents enjoy access to beautiful parks such as Pocahontas State Park, which is perfect for hiking, biking, and picnicking. For those who love shopping and dining, Midlothian boasts a variety of options including the bustling Midlothian Towne Center, where you can find everything from popular retail stores to cozy coffee shops and diverse restaurants.

One of the standout attractions in Midlothian is the historic Mid-Lothian Mines Park, a fascinating site that offers a glimpse into the area's coal mining past with scenic trails and educational displays. This adds a unique cultural charm to the neighborhood, blending history with nature. Families will appreciate the excellent school options nearby, along with community centers that offer recreational activities year-round. The neighborhood’s welcoming vibe is further enhanced by local events and farmers markets that foster a strong sense of community among residents.

While Midlothian enjoys a quieter suburban feel, it remains conveniently close to Downtown Richmond, with an approximate 20 to 25-minute drive depending on traffic. This proximity allows residents to easily access the city’s rich cultural scene, professional opportunities, and entertainment options without sacrificing the tranquility of suburban living. Whether you’re commuting for work or heading out for a night on the town, Midlothian provides a perfect balance between accessibility and a relaxed lifestyle. For anyone moving to Richmond, this neighborhood offers a wonderful place to call home with plenty to explore and enjoy.

Midlothian Demographics

Population 3,701
Density (People/sqml.) 2,640
Median Age 34.8
Married Couples
31%
31% of the population of Midlothian aged 16 years and older are married.
Have Kids
26%
26% of the population aged 16 years or older have children.

About 31% of the Midlothian population aged 16 and older are married, which is notably lower than average. This could suggest a community with a younger, more transient population—perhaps made up of students, professionals, or renters. It may also reflect a neighborhood that attracts singles or couples without children, contributing to a more independent, urban lifestyle.

With only 26% of people over 16 having children, you can expect an easygoing environment that tends to attract residents seeking a quieter lifestyle. The atmosphere here leans more toward adult-oriented living. Without the constant rhythm of school schedules or kid-centered events, the community maintains a slower, more relaxed pace. This makes it especially appealing to singles, couples, and empty nesters who appreciate tranquil streets, and recreation on their own terms.

Housing

? /10
Home Price $163,875
Median Rent $1,220
People/Household 2.4

Home Price Breakdown

Midlothian neighborhood home price breakdown chart

Rent vs Own

Rent 59% Own 41%

Year Moved In

Before 2010 61% After 2010 39%

Types of Homes in the Area

Market Trends

Year-over-Year Home Prices YoY data

 

Housing trends offer valuable insight into the accessibility and character of a neighborhood. In Midlothian, the median home price is $163,875, which is less than many surrounding areas. This affordability makes it an attractive option for first-time buyers, young families, or anyone looking to enter the housing market without a significant financial barrier. Looking at appreciation rates and past market trends in Midlothian can offer valuable insight into the neighborhood’s investment potential. Understanding how home values have changed over time helps buyers gauge future growth, assess long-term stability, and make more informed real estate decisions.

The median rent is around $1,220, which is on par with many comparable neighborhoods. This balanced pricing offers a mix of affordability and value, making it a practical choice for a wide range of renters.
